Team DNA map

Visualize your sales team's personality composition with radar charts that show each member's strengths. Use the insights to route leads to the right agent and build a balanced team.

Completing the personality assessment

Each team member must complete a short personality assessment before they appear on the DNA map:

  1. Navigate to Team DNA in the sidebar (or ask the team member to open their Personality page).
  2. Start the assessment. The assessment consists of scenario-based questions about sales situations. It takes approximately 5 minutes to complete.
  3. Submit answers. Once submitted, the system calculates scores across the five dimensions and generates the radar chart.

Results are not pass/fail — every personality type has strengths in sales. The assessment identifies where those strengths lie so you can leverage them.

Have your entire team complete the assessment in the same week. This gives you the full team picture immediately rather than waiting for results to trickle in.

Reading the radar chart

Each agent's profile shows a five-point radar chart. The further a point extends from the center, the stronger that dimension is for the agent. A perfectly balanced agent would have an even pentagon; most agents skew toward two or three strengths.

Frequently asked

Can an agent retake the assessment?+
Yes. Agents can retake the assessment at any time from their Personality page. The new results replace the previous ones on the DNA map.
Are the results shared with the whole team?+
Only Admins and Owners can see the full team DNA map. Agents see only their own radar chart and personality summary. This keeps individual results private while giving managers the team-level view.
Does the assessment affect my account or leads?+
No. The assessment is purely informational. It does not change permissions, lead visibility, or any account settings. It exists to help managers make smarter routing decisions.
What if my team is too small for meaningful DNA analysis?+
Team DNA is useful even for teams of two or three. It helps you understand individual strengths and assign leads accordingly. As your team grows, the team-wide visualization becomes more powerful for spotting gaps.
Can I use DNA data to automate lead routing?+
Currently, DNA insights are manual — you use them to inform your routing rules and assignment decisions. Automated DNA-based routing is on the product roadmap.
